作为一种集合多种不同对战棋类游戏的休闲娱乐平台,棋牌游戏已经成为了社交娱乐的热门选项之一。相较于电子游戏,棋牌游戏更加易于上手且需要思考,同时还能与朋友或陌生人进行对战比拼,因此不少人对此非常钟爱,并且大量玩家愿意在棋牌游戏上消磨时间和放松身心。

伴随着移动网络和智能终端的普及,棋牌游戏行业进入了一个火爆的时期,市场的巨大发展空间也为棋牌游戏开发的团队带来了无限的机遇。要开发一款优秀的棋牌游戏,除了需要在界面设计、画面制作上用心,积累丰富的游戏经验外,更需要具备独特的游戏玩法,这才能让游戏在市场上获得更大的反响,成为玩家喜爱的绝对经典。
因此,这篇文章希望从棋牌源码开发角度出发,给广大棋牌游戏开发团队提供对创新游戏玩法的一些思考和启示。
一、什么是棋牌源码?
要全面领会什么是棋牌源码,首先需要明白什么是源码。源码就是程序员用于开发软件的基本代码,它包含了软件系统的核心数据结构、算法、接口实现等。获取了源码,用户可以根据自己的需求修改代码,定制游戏的特色玩法,并将游戏上线市场进行推广。
当谈及棋牌源码,它最主要作用就是帮助棋牌游戏的开发人员快速定位各个游戏板块的架构,避免从头开始开发。基本的棋牌源码包括了游戏的前端、后端、网站的制作等,开发人员可以参考源码中结构的实现,提高游戏设计和开发的效率。
二、棋牌游戏的特色玩法
谈及创新独特的游戏玩法,首先需要了解市场上的棋牌游戏主要有哪些类型和特点。下面将就几种经典的棋牌游戏玩法进行简单介绍:
1、麻将:是一种多人对战游戏,其玩法依赖于不同的规则和牌型。在我国,规定牌型的普及最广,通行于南北各地方。由于其复杂的牌型和多重规则,玩家在玩麻将时需要保持清晰的头脑,持续分析当前的牌型和各个玩家的出牌习惯,才能收获最后的胜利。
2、斗地主:是一种使用扑克牌,3人对战的扑克牌游戏。通常由红桃3和黑桃3和各条都算是百搭的星星牌组成,选定一名玩家作为地主,其余两人联手一起进行对战。在游戏中,玩家的策略主要依赖于手中的牌型和当前出牌的方式,需要沉着稳重的思考和判断。
3、五子棋:是一种二人对战的棋盘游戏,它的前身是中国的弈棋。玩家用黑、白两色通过轮流下子,在棋盘上形成连成一线的五颗子就是获胜。这样的游戏不仅需要扎实的棋艺,还需要寻找到对手出现的弱点,并及时加以利用。
以上仅是市场上较为主流的几种棋牌游戏,当然,还有许多未被开发的棋牌游戏,等待有想法和实力的开发团队去挖掘和发掘。
开发人员应该遵循什么样的游戏设计原则呢?笔者认为空间,时间,机会及动作(STOA)是游戏设计的重要因素:
1、空间:一个好的游戏应该有足够的空间让玩家行动,并且空间应该是充满活力的、令人向往的。
2、时间:一个好的游戏应该有合适的游戏时间规划,不应过长或过短。
3、机会:一个好的游戏应该充分考虑机会。例如,一些道具、加成等等,让人想要去取得这些加成。
4、动作:一个好的游戏应该充分考虑此游戏所需要使用到的动作等细节,以保证玩家的愉悦程度。
三、如何开发棋牌源码和游戏
从玩家的视角,一个好的游戏应该不仅仅是有趣,还应定义清楚玩家参与游戏的动机,以及让玩家在游戏中感到独特体验的元素。因此,任何一个模仿、抄袭已有成型玩法的游戏很难获得市场的认可,只有在创新独特玩法并付诸实现后才可能获得突破。
下面将就棋牌源码开发的四个方面,逐一介绍如何实现自己的棋牌游戏:
1、玩法定制
选择母版源码、改码、定制需要添加的新游戏板块和规则等都是开发过程中的基本方法。对于一名优秀开发人员而言,他需要在设计和编码中脑中先画出自己的游戏框架,加入创新的元素以实现自己的理想。
2、前端开发
在前端开发的过程中,需要完整设计游戏UI,美化玩家的视觉体验。游戏的开发中,画面的精致和速度都是玩家非常关心的。
3、后端开发
从服务器端开发来说,需要实现游戏的核心逻辑,存储玩家数据,将数据传递到前端展示。同时对于网络环境不佳或大量玩家的情况,服务器要应对足够的压力情况能够应对,保证游戏体验的顺畅。
4、移动端开发
现在大部分玩家都是在手机上玩游戏,这便使棋牌游戏的移动端开发成为了一个不可回避的问题。在开发中,需有主流的界面设计,有清晰的游戏棋盘和足够的手势操作,保证同样的游戏致力在移动端也能有相似的体验。
四、总结
棋牌源码开发是一个具有挑战性也充满挑战的工作,但谁确定开发出的游戏不能成为市场突破的一款优秀游戏呢?当有了决心,想法、实力和勇气,每一步的迈进就是前进,最终获得的就是玩家的肯定和市场的成功。希望本篇文章能够为读者提供一些有益的启发和思路,引领更多人走向棋牌游戏领域的殿堂。


QQ客服专员
电话客服专员